Lorde's message to her fans...."flaws are OK"

If you needed more proof that Lorde isn’t your average teen (if, say, the multiple Grammys and MAC collaboration weren’t enough), here it is: The “Royals” singer just posted a photo of herself that shows her skin, both Photoshopped and as it actually is, while slamming the retouching in a sweet message to her fans.

“i find this curious – two photos from today, one edited so my skin is perfect and one real. remember flaws are ok ,” she captioned the picture, which shows one performance photo with her skin blurred to a smooth finish and another without any extra production.

Lorde is the latest star to reject overly retouched photos of herself. Shailene Woodley recently shared that she hates the way magazines make her look like something she’s not, while lots of stars are posting no makeup selfies to Instagram. Lorde, however, has gone even a step further than that, posting a selfie with her acne cream on.
